From the folder where the code was downloaded with 'git clone' you can run 'git pull' to pull the latest GitHub check-ins.
Also, with apt-get, there is no guarantee you will get the latest or the best. Sometimes it best to go to the git repo and pull the latest checked in code and build and install from there. Of course, it is wise to check the Readme and see what was added or taken away from the posted code.
